Sun Group has signed a strategic cooperation agreement with two global education giants, Canadian Aviation Electronics Ltd. (CAE) and EHL Hospitality Business School (EHL) from Switzerland to establish two world class training institutions in Vietnam. The Sun Aviation Academy (SAA) and the Sun Tourism Academy (STA).
The initiative marks Sun Group’s major entry into the education and training sector, focusing on building skilled human resources for Vietnam’s growing aviation and hospitality industries.
Canadian Aviation Electronics with over 75 years of experience in aviation training, will support the development of the Sun Aviation Academy in partnership with the Civil Aviation Authority of Vietnam. The academy will offer internationally approved training for pilots, flight attendants, and ground staff. It aims to not only support Sun Phu Quoc Airways, Sun Group’s airline venture, but also become a regional leader in aviation education.
On the hospitality front, EHL, regarded as the ‘Harvard of Hospitality’, will work with Sun Group to build the Sun Tourism Academy. The school will train future leaders and professionals in hotel and service management, based on global standards.

Dang Minh Truong, Chairman of Sun Group said, “We are developing these academies to train young Vietnamese talents with global knowledge and the right service mindset. This partnership goes beyond education, it's about shaping the future of Vietnam’s tourism and aviation”.
This move aligns with Sun Group’s vision of creating a comprehensive ecosystem from luxury travel and real estate to aviation and now education positioning Vietnam as a world class destination.
